Output 83868fa668d9fdb65726fcd2cd9ae532afeb4d3553b26dc683c9190b2684efc9:0

value
1034774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8774a46559c3418eadcb9a995be7f25b00b29c00 OP_EQUAL
address
3E3Est3zR9TUNzdbmri6oCqfh6eZ94sHkW
transaction
83868fa668d9fdb65726fcd2cd9ae532afeb4d3553b26dc683c9190b2684efc9
confirmations
340920
spent
true